A grand family estate commanding pride of place in the elite upper echelon of prestigious Eaglemont property, 'Innisfail' c1928 is a magnificent double-storey, 14-room residence scenically elevated on an expansive 2202m2 allotment (approx) backing directly onto exclusive Outlook Park.
A rare jewel in legendary architect Walter Burley Griffin's blue-ribbon Mount Eagle Estate, this illustrious American-inspired domain's unrivalled double-block setting amid flourishing botanical grounds is a breathtaking sight to behold.
The grandeur begins with a classically patterned terrazzo verandah introducing a stately timber-paneled reception hall that leads to adjoining formal sitting and dining rooms (ornate fireplace and heater) framed by the timeless elegance of a glorious past and opening to a full-width, eastside covered terrace.
The ground-floor layout extends to a huge main bedroom, with city views and an ensuite, before a family living room opening to a conservatory-style sunroom, a study, a powder room and a large laundry, along with a well-appointed kitchen and meals area.
Complemented by a versatile games room or extra bedroom while flanked by an additional sunroom with spectacular city views and two separate studies plus a family bathroom, first-floor accommodation is superbly spaced for peaceful privacy and comprises three king-sized bedrooms (built-in robes) including one with its own ensuite.
Other attributes of this character-filled home include solar electricity, ducted heating, evaporative cooling, copious attic storage, a BBQ area, storerooms, return driveway entry and remote-control garaging for four cars and a further two off-street car spaces.
An unrivalled opening in a supreme position that's exceedingly comfortable with stunning potential to luxuriously restore its celebrated glory, 'Innisfail' stands as a testament to time-honoured architecture and is a once in a lifetime opportunity close to river parkland and the Main Yarra Trail, East Ivanhoe Village cafes, Ivanhoe and Burgundy Street and shopping precincts, train station, leading schools, freeway and the Austin and Mercy Hospitals.

The size of Eaglemont is approximately 2.2 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 20.2% of total area. The population of Eaglemont in 2016 was 3873 people. By 2021 the population was 3960 showing a population growth of 2.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Eaglemont is 60-69 years. Households in Eaglemont are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Eaglemont work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 78.00% of the homes in Eaglemont were owner-occupied compared with 77.90% in 2016.
